How much does it cost to rent a home in King?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
King 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| C$1,992 | C$1,500 | C$2,700 |
King 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| C$3,189 | C$1,800 | C$4,850 |
King 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| C$4,031 | C$2,880 | C$5,800 |
King 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| C$4,532 | C$3,650 | C$5,180 |
King 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| C$5,649 | C$5,299 | C$5,999 |
King 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| C$6,300 | C$6,300 | C$6,300 |

Frequently Asked Questions about King
What type of rentals are currently available in King?
There are currently 54 Apartments for Rent in King, ON with pricing that ranges from C$1,895 to C$2,295. There are also 104 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in King ranging from C$1,125 to C$6,300.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in King?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in King ranges from C$1,125 to C$6,300 with an average monthly rent of C$3,642.
